  2. I have the Cinemonitor hd and I don't even own a hood the thing is so bright (at "user 100%") setting. It's got an amazing level and I upgraded to inertia compensation horizon, which isn't really needed.

    There is even a 6" version that they came out with that comes with a brighter screen and the upgraded horizon stock... Couldn't imagine even brighter.

     

    However, I used the Transvideo Rainbow when I had to send mine in and I couldn't see anything ... LIKE ANYTHING it was terrible. Had some cool features, but you could really only use it as a AC monitor with a nice hood.
